/*Testimonials*/
.testimonials-index-index .toolbar.top .pager .toolbar-amount		{ display:none; }
.testimonials-index-index .toolbar.top .pager .limiter				{ float:right; }
.testimonials-index-index .toolbar.top .pager .pages				{ display:none; }
.testimonials-index-index .toolbar.bottom .pager .toolbar-amount	{ float:left; }
.testimonials-index-index .toolbar.bottom .pager .limiter			{ display:none; }
.testimonials-index-index .toolbar.bottom .pager .pages				{ float:right; }

.testimonials-index-index .page-title-wrapper {
	padding:0;
	display:inline-block;
}
.testimonials-index-index .page-title {
	display:inline-block;
}

.testimonials-toolbar.top {
	float:right;
	margin:-5px 0 15px 30px;
}

.testimonials-toolbar.bottom {
	margin-top:15px;
}

.content_inner {
	padding:25px;
}

 .col-main .customer-testimonials {
	margin:0 25px;
}
.sidebar .view-more{
	display:block;
	font-weight: bold;
	color: #0F5B92;
	padding-bottom: 5px;
}
.sidebar .block-testimonial-sidebar .block-content {
	padding: 0;
	font-size:11px;
}
.name-date-testimonial{
	color: rgb(10, 38, 60);
	display: block;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-variant: normal;
	font-weight: bold;
	height: 16px;
	line-height: 16.2000007629395px;
	margin-bottom: 0px;
	margin-left: 0px;
	margin-right: 0px;
	margin-top: 0px;
	padding-bottom: 0px;
	padding-left: 0px;
	padding-right: 0px;
	padding-top: 0px;
	text-align: right;
	width: 172px;
}
.name-date-testimonial .date{
	display: block;
}

.testimonial-entry {
	padding: 20px;
}

.testimonial-entry  {
	margin-bottom: 20px;
}

.testimonial-entry.odd {
	background: #F8F8F8;
	border-top: 1px dashed #E0E0E0;
	border-bottom: 1px dashed #E0E0E0;
}

.testimonial-tagline {
	font-family: Lucida Sans Unicode, Arial, sans-serif !important;
	font-weight: normal !important;
	font-size: 16px !important;
	margin: 0 !important;
}

.testimonial-content {
	display:flex;
	margin-bottom:30px;
}

.testimonial-content-avatar {
	flex-basis: 120px;
	flex-grow: 0;
	padding: 4px 10px 0 0;
}
.testimonial-content-description {
	flex-basis: 120px;
	flex-grow: 1;
}

.testimonial-source {
	font-family: Lucida Sans Unicode, Arial, sans-serif;
	position: absolute;
	bottom: 5px;
	right: 10px;
}

.testimonial-author {
	font-size: 12px;
	font-style: normal;
	color: #0A233C;
	text-align: right;
	display: block;
	font-weight: bold;
}

.testimonial-www {
	font-style: normal;
	text-align: right;
	display: block;
}

.testimonial-date {
	font-size: 10px;
	text-align: right;
	display: none;
	font-weight: bold;
}


.customer-testimonials .page-title {
	margin: 0 0 10px;
}
.customer-testimonials .page-title h1 {
	color: #464646;
    float: left;
    font-size: 17px;
    font-weight: bold;
    text-transform: uppercase;
}

.customer-testimonials .page-title button {
	float: right;
}

.block-testimonial .testimonial-entry {
	padding: 0;
}

.block-testimonial .testimonial-content {
	margin: 0 !important;
	font-style: italic;
	padding-bottom: 5px;
}

.block-testimonial .testimonial-container {
	padding: 8px;
}

.block-testimonial .pagination {
	padding: 5px 8px 10px;
	margin-bottom: 15px;
}

.block-testimonial .pagination .btn-prev {
	background: url("../../images/testimonial/navigation-left.png") no-repeat scroll left top transparent;
	float: left;
}

.block-testimonial .pagination .btn-next {
	background: url("../../images/testimonial/navigation-right.png") no-repeat scroll left top transparent;
	float: right;
}

.block-testimonial .pagination a {
	height: 0;
	overflow: hidden;
	padding-top: 18px;
	width: 18px;
	display: block;
}

/*-- Block Testimonial Sidebar --*/

.block-testimonial-sidebar .block-content {padding: 5px 9px;}
.block-testimonial-sidebar .block-content .testimonial-sidebar-content {padding: 0 0 15px; float: left;}
.block-testimonial-sidebar .block-content .std {float: left; width: 100%;}
.block-testimonial-sidebar .block-content .std .tooltip {font-size: 11px;}
.block-testimonial-sidebar .block-content .name-date-testimonial {float: left; width: 100%; text-align: right;}
.block-testimonial-sidebar .block-content .name-date-testimonial h6 {margin: 0;}
.block-testimonial-sidebar .block-content .name-date-testimonial .name {font-size: 12px;}

/*=======================================*/


/*-- Customer Testimonial Content --*/
.customer-testimonials {
	clear: both;
	display: grid;
	grid-template-columns: repeat(auto-fit, minmax(350px, 1fr));
	grid-gap: 30px 30px;
}

.customer-testimonials .customer-testimonials-content {    
	overflow: hidden;
	display: block;
	min-height: 125px;
	border: 1px solid #e5e5e5;
	padding: 10px;
	position:relative;
}
